Transaction 1238abd3ff0a4085f7c45f85bc0ec85073905d154c1dc36dc1826c5153200006

block
44951e6bb1d03763634c6c8bd4c49e5abd12983c4fe5ffcb1772dfa8398122b9

1 Input

24 Outputs